Nishant Malik, Rochester Institute of Technology, Data-driven analysis of monsoon dynamics: ancient civilizational changes over South Asia to modern forecasting

November 9, 2021 | 3:00 pm - 4:00 pm EST

Monsoons are significant atmospheric phenomena that manifest over various regions in the tropics and have massive social and economic consequences. We will present hybrid methods that combine ideas from dynamical systems-based nonlinear time series analysis and machine learning and analyze the dynamics of the South Asian monsoon. Specifically, we will show two sets of results, one on a paleoclimate time series from the Holocene and another using a large-scale spatiotemporal temperature field from the reanalysis data set. In the first set of results, we identify dynamical transitions in the paleoclimate time series and show that these transitions correspond to civilizational evolution over South Asia. For this purpose, we integrate the recurrence plot method with manifold learning. In the second set, we combine climate network analysis of spatiotemporal data of global temperatures with decision tree-based regression to forecast monsoon on different temporal and spatial scales.
